Man & Woman, "Sex on the Minitel" (2001)
This twelve-inch single features two high energy house songs cut at 45 RPM. <br /><br />Side A: "Sex on the Minitel" <br />Side B: "Man & Minitel" <br /><br />The record is packaged in a clear plastic sleeve with a small sticker. The only liner notes are the artist's name and a link to <a href="http://www.manandwomanmusic.co.uk" title="www.manandwomanmusic.co.uk">www.manandwomanmusic.co.uk</a> <br /><br />Man & Woman Music, 2001

Minitel Follies
<p>"Minitel Follies" was published in <a href="https://www.comics.org/issue/167525/"><em>Gay Comix </em>issue 12 for Spring/Summer 1988</a>. <br /><br />The six page comic follows the (mis)adventures of Fox as he looks for love on the Minitel. In the opening panels, Fox picks up a terminal from the local post office and rushes home to set it up and type "3...6...1...5..."</p>
<p>"Minitel Follies" is also notable in <a href="https://en.wikifur.com/wiki/History">the histories of furry fandom and underground comix</a>.<br /><br />Special thanks to <a href="https://rudenshiold.com/">Alexander Rudenshiold</a> for locating, scanning, and sharing "Minitel Follies" and to <a href="https://twitter.com/CBPolt/">Christopher Polt</a> for <a href="https://twitter.com/CBPolt/status/1645052854950928387">posting images of the comic</a> online.<br /><br /><br /></p>

Taboo, "Crac Absolument" b/w "Complètement Dèchirée" (Just'In Distribution, Year Unknown)
A truly unusual pop single featuring two tracks by Taboo about a popular messagerie called Crac. The front of the sleeve depicts a partially nude Taboo flying over the keyboard of a Minitel terminal with the instructions "Telephone 3615 / Tapez CRAC" superimposed on the screen. The year of publication is still unknown though CRAC advertisements from late-1980s mentioned the record.
